Die Wacht am Rhein


Die Wacht am Rhein, composed by Carl Wilhelm, is a patriotic German song written in the original key of C major. It was first performed in 1854 and gained popularity during the Franco-Prussian War. The song became a symbol of German unity and patriotism, emphasizing the defense of the Rhine River against foreign invasion. The lyrics highlight the bravery and dedication of German soldiers protecting their homeland.
